Working Principle of Hose Pump

When the hose pump works, the rotor body rotates, and a pair of pressure
rollers on the rotor body rotate along a special rubber tube. The
extrusion force produced by the pressure rollers and the pump shell
flattens the rubber tube. Under the force of the elasticity of the tube
itself and the side guide roll, the liquid is sucked into the tube through the
vacuum generated by restoring the original state, and the liquid is
discharged from the tube under the mechanical extrusion of the pressure
roll, thus reciprocating. The pump has simple structure and easy
fabrication. The durability of the pump mainly depends on the elasticity
and corrosion resistance of the pipe. Its flow rate is related to the
speed of the motor and the diameter of the pipe. Therefore, the key is
to select the pipe and speed control mechanism. As long as the pipe has a
long life and stable speed, it is no problem to maintain long-term
quantitative transmission
